8 killed in school shooting in Austria

At least eight people were killed and several others injured in a school shooting Tuesday in the southern Austrian city of Graz, local media reported.

Austria's interior ministry confirming that several people had been killed at a Graz school.

A police operation was underway at the BORG Dreierschützengasse school, a secondary school located in the northwest of the city, Austrian police said in a series of posts on X.

The police added that several emergency services, tactical units and a helicopter had been deployed to the area. “The situation is secure. No further danger is expected,” it said in a post on X.

Police spokesman Fritz Grundnig told Austrian public broadcaster ORF that police had evacuated the building after gunshots were heard.

Those injured included students and teachers, who were taken to the nearby Helmut List Hall events space for emergency care, according to Austrian newspaper Kronen Zeitung.

A meeting point was set up for the students’ parents at the ASKÖ football stadium, the police said.

It was not immediately clear whether the suspected perpetrator was among those injured.
